Masterarbeit – Asynchrone Code-Ausführung auf Embedded Systems
Dortmund, Köln, Paderborn/Büren
Job-ID: 422 | Veröffentlicht: 2022-02-28 | Karriere-Level: Abschlussarbeit | Vertragsart: befristet
To Do's
Im Rahmen deiner Tätigkeit entwickelst du eine nebenläufige, asynchrone Anwendung und realisierst diese mit aktuellen Sprachmitteln der Programmiersprachen C++, Rust sowie einem handelsüblichen RTOS.
- Du konzipierst die Anwendung. Die Demo kann eine Zutrittskontrolle, Heizungsregelung, Raumluftüberwachung oder eine Applikation realisieren, die dich interessiert.
- Du recherchierst, welche Sprachmittel und Frameworks zur asynchronen Ausführung zur Verfügung stehen und wie du diese mit einem RTOS vergleichen kannst.
- Du erarbeitest die Architektur und Implementierung der Firmware, um das Gesamtsystem in Betrieb zu nehmen.
- Zur Performance-Messung der Lösungen entwickelst du eine automatisierte Testumgebung und setzt dein Testkonzept um.
Deine Skills
- Spaß und hohe Eigenmotivation bei der Lösung technischer Aufgabenstellungen
- Erste Kenntnisse in der Softwareentwicklung mit C / C++, Rust oder Python
- Idealerweise Erfahrungen mit Software für Embedded Systems (Arduino, STM32 Cube, PlatformIO)
- Laufendes Studium im Bereich der (technischen) Informatik, Elektrotechnik o. ä.
- Verhandlungssicheres Deutsch und fließendes Englisch
Be part of Smart
Für alle Fragen bereit:
Lisa Halfar
Telefon +49 231 841685-203
Wir freuen uns, Dich kennenzulernen!
Wir sind Smart
Seit 2008 sind wir Entwicklungspartner für intelligente vernetzte Systeme. Unser Fokus liegt auf der Produktentwicklung, dem Produktmanagement und der technischen Beratung für unsere Kunden. Unser Ziel ist es, mit spannenden und innovativen Lösungen unsere Kunden und uns zu begeistern.
Smart Mechatronics wurde als „Top Arbeitgeber Mittelstand 2022“ ausgezeichnet.